With an intensity of over 150 klx at 300 mm WD in continuous operation, the SL316 UltraSeal Spot Light delivers industry-leading intensity with consistent uniformity.
-
Available with narrow, medium, and wide lensing options as well as a non-lensed configuration for high dispersion.
-
Configurable in eleven wavelength options.
-
Compatible with all Ai inline and discreet control systems. The SL316 can be operated in continuous, gated continuous, pulsed, and adaptive pulsed modes with dimming options for brightness control.

Enables coaxial measurements up to 10,000 V and 300 A pulsed (600 A in a parallel configuration) with a single touchdown
-
Even distribution of high current with innovative multi-fingertip design
-
Compatible with TESLA 200/300 mm power device characterization system
-
Reduced measurement time by testing both high-voltage and high-current conditions with a single touchdown
-
Accurate characterization of a wide range of pad sizes and test currents, with minimum pad damage and contact resistance
-
Safe, reliable and repeatable high-current/voltage measurements over a wide temperature range (from -55°C to +300°C)

-
Provides an effectively noise free environment around the device under test (DUT)
-
World’s first probe station with integrated TestCell Power Management (a TestCell is a connected set of equipment, including test software, instruments, probe station, thermal system, and related measurement accessories such as cables and on-wafer probes)
-
Up to 4x faster flicker noise thermal testing on 30 μm pads
-
Provides dark and dry environment for measuring light sensitive transistors, and devices at negative temperatures (<= -60°C) with frost free operation
-
Provides fully managed and filtered AC power to the entire system – prober and instruments
-
Filters harmful noise generated by external thermal control systems
-
Reduced “antenna effect” injection of unwanted RF noise into the measurement path
-
Provide up to 100dB attenuation (50Hz to 80Mhz) with 100mA max DC current handling
-
Ultra-low, fA-level current and fF-level capacitance measurements from -65 °C to + 300 °C

Trenton Systems
Founded in 1989, Trenton Systems provides the defense, government, industrial, and commercial markets with advanced, TAA-compliant high-performance computing solutions designed in consultation with customers. Equipped with the latest processing, AI/ML/DL, networking, security, and storage technologies, our solutions are designed in collaboration with our global partnership ecosystem.
All solutions, whether configurable or custom, are engineered right here in the USA within a vetted and transparent supply chain and fortified by comprehensive multi-layer cybersecurity across the hardware, firmware, software, and network stack. Proactive risk management methodologies coupled with zero trust provisioning ensure maximum reliability, longevity, and operational efficiency.
Trenton Systems’ rugged computing solutions meet or exceed the most stringent military and industrial standards, and are produced in the company’s headquarters in Atlanta, GA, which is certified to ISO 9001:2015 and AS9100D quality management standards.
Trenton Systems also provides in-house engineering, comprehensive lifecycle management, BIOS customization, strict revision control, and an industry-leading five-year warranty program.
